First off Jasper... that article on 331 ways to waste an ls1 was a supercharged motor.

Okay secondly, a 331 stroker kit from eagle is nice. You should probably research different companies, like dss, etc. A 331 is better for the lighter cars like mustangs. A 347 will have more torque for the heavier cars.The 347 isn't as reliable as a 331 in the long run. Either motor is a terrific for street cars.

Now as for the budget... good luck.

P.S. The stock headswill have to be at least ported. There is noway you will make power with stock heads and intake. just my 2 cents
